What are flexible buildings?

Flex-buildings are buildings that are literally designed to change. Flexibility is defined as the capacity of a building to undergo modifications and accept changes of function with limited structural interventions. More than 40% of the activities housed in a flex building can continue to function during modification.

Which type of building structure is considered as more flexible?

Steel building offers more design and architectural flexibility for unique or conventional styling. Its strength and large clear spans mean the design is not constrained by the need for intermediate support walls. As your requirements changes over the years, you can reuse, relocate, & modify the structure.

How do you develop flexibility?

Design for flexibility

  1. Use interstitial space.
  2. Provide programmed soft space, such as administration or storage, equal to at least 5% of departmental gross area (DGA).
  3. Provide shell space equal to at least 5% of DGA.

What are the benefits of a flexible architecture?

The largest benefit of flexible architecture is the ability to keep the built environment relevant and useful as time goes on. Occupant needs can change drastically even in the span of just a decade, and this typically results in the need for buildings to undergo renovations or other updates.

Where did the term flexible architecture come from?

The term “flexible architecture” was popularized in the book Flexible: Architecture that Responds to Change by Robert Kronenburg. Kronenburg noted that the majority of architecture is static and doesn’t change or adapt over time. This stands in contrast to the natural world, which adapts to its surroundings.

What does Groak mean by flexibility in architecture?

Groák tries to explain the the adaptability related to the use of space whilst flexibility refers to different physical arrangement.He emphasize that flexibility is valid not only for interior but also for the exterior adjustments. In this respect,it can be inferred that Groák agrees with the definition of Rabeneck, Sheppard and Town.
